Lepke


starring: Tony Curtis, Anjanette Comer, Michael Callan, Warren Berlinger, Gianni Russo
directed by: Menahem Golan


:Description:Tony Curtis stars as Lepke, head of Murder Inc., the syndicate that spattered the headlines of the day with blood. From his rough-and-toumble East Side childhood to his rise in the drug trade to his 1944 execution at Sing Sing, Lepke depicts with brute force the criminal career of a man with more than 60 murders to his credit.

Over the Brooklyn Bridge (Amazon.com Exclusive)


starring: Elliott Gould, Margaux Hemingway, Sid Caesar, Carol Kane, Burt Young
directed by: Menahem Golan


:Description:Alby Sherman is a man with a deli and a dream. He's looking to sell his greasy spoon in Brooklyn and buy a swanky Manhattan restaurant. His Uncle Benjamin will lend him the money, but only on the condition that Alby dump Elizabeth, his non-Jewish girlfriend, and marry one of the faith. Now Alby has to choose between his business and a dish who's definitely not on the menu.
